Understanding Ondansetron

Ondansetron is a selective 5-HT3 receptor antagonist that works by blocking serotonin receptors in the brain and gut, thereby reducing nausea and vomiting. It is commonly prescribed for various conditions, including chemotherapy-induced nausea and vomiting (CINV), postoperative nausea and vomiting (PONV), and gastroenteritis.

Administration and Monitoring

Ondansetron can be administered orally, intravenously, or via intramuscular injection, depending on the clinical situation and the patient’s ability to tolerate oral medications. Monitoring is crucial to assess the effectiveness of the treatment and to detect any adverse effects.

Oral Administration

Oral Ondansetron is available in tablet and oral solution forms. It should be taken with or without food, as directed by the healthcare provider. For pediatric patients who have difficulty swallowing tablets, the oral solution can be a more convenient option.

Intravenous Administration

Intravenous Ondansetron is typically used in hospital settings for patients who cannot take oral medications or require immediate relief from nausea and vomiting. The dose is administered slowly over 2-5 minutes to minimize the risk of adverse reactions.

Intramuscular Administration

Intramuscular Ondansetron is less commonly used but can be administered when intravenous access is not available. The dose is injected into a large muscle mass, such as the gluteal or deltoid muscle.

Common Side Effects

While Ondansetron is generally well-tolerated, it can cause side effects in some patients. Common side effects include:

  • Headache
  • Constipation
  • Diarrhea
  • Fatigue
  • Dizziness

More serious side effects, although rare, can include:

  • QT prolongation, which can lead to serious heart rhythm abnormalities.
  • Serotonin syndrome, especially when Ondansetron is used in combination with other serotonergic drugs.
  • Allergic reactions, including anaphylaxis.

Special Considerations

Certain patient populations may require special considerations when administering Ondansetron. These include:

Neonates and Infants

Ondansetron is generally not recommended for neonates and infants due to limited safety data and the potential for serious adverse effects. Alternative antiemetic agents should be considered for this age group.

Patients with Hepatic Impairment

In patients with hepatic impairment, the clearance of Ondansetron may be reduced, leading to higher plasma concentrations and an increased risk of adverse effects. Dose adjustments may be necessary, and close monitoring is essential.

Patients with Renal Impairment

Ondansetron is primarily metabolized by the liver, and its clearance is not significantly affected by renal impairment. However, patients with severe renal impairment may still require dose adjustments and close monitoring.

Patients with QT Prolongation

Ondansetron can prolong the QT interval, which can increase the risk of serious heart rhythm abnormalities. Patients with pre-existing QT prolongation or those taking other medications that prolong the QT interval should be closely monitored.
